Zpaq Manager is an open-source file archiver and compressor for Windows. It provides a GUI for the powerful Zpaq compression software, allowing users to easily archive and extract files with high compression ratios.
7-Zip is a free and open source file archiver with very high compression ratios. It supports 7z, ZIP, GZIP, BZIP2, XZ and other formats. It is available for Windows, Linux and macOS.
